Understanding Hybrid Meeting Room Technology Components

Hybrid meeting room technology encompasses a wide range of hardware and software components that work together to create an integrated experience. Businesses in Mission Viejo seeking to implement these solutions need to understand the essential elements that make up effective hybrid meeting spaces. Professional installers assess organizational needs and recommend appropriate technology combinations while ensuring these systems integrate seamlessly with existing IT infrastructure.

  • Audio Equipment: High-quality microphones with noise cancellation, omnidirectional ceiling mics, speaker systems, and acoustic treatment to ensure remote participants can hear and be heard clearly.
  • Video Technology: HD cameras with wide-angle capabilities, multiple camera setups for large rooms, auto-tracking features, and video processing systems that capture in-room participants effectively.
  • Display Solutions: Interactive displays, multiple monitors, digital whiteboards, and content sharing systems that allow collaborative work on documents in real-time.
  • Network Infrastructure: Dedicated high-bandwidth internet connections, quality of service configurations, and redundant systems to prevent meeting disruptions.
  • Meeting Management Software: Platforms that enable scheduling, participant management, and integration with calendar systems for streamlined operations.

IT Integration and Security Considerations

For Mission Viejo businesses, the integration of hybrid meeting technology with existing IT systems requires careful planning and execution. Professional installers work closely with internal IT departments to ensure new systems align with company policies and security requirements. This collaboration is crucial for maintaining data integrity and network security while enabling the functionality hybrid meetings demand.

  • Network Security Assessment: Comprehensive evaluation of existing network infrastructure to identify potential vulnerabilities before connecting new meeting room technology.
  • Encryption Protocols: Implementation of end-to-end encryption for all meeting data, ensuring confidential discussions remain secure from interception.
  • Access Control Systems: Development of role-based access controls for meeting technology, limiting system functionality based on user credentials.
  • Firmware Management: Regular updating of all hardware components to address security vulnerabilities and improve performance.
  • Segmented Networks: Creation of separate network segments for meeting technology to contain potential security breaches and protect core business systems.

Security-focused installers in Mission Viejo understand that compliance requirements vary by industry. Healthcare organizations may need HIPAA-compliant solutions, while financial institutions require systems that meet stringent data protection standards. Professional installers help navigate these requirements, implementing appropriate safeguards while ensuring system usability. Cybersecurity Measures for Hybrid Meeting Environments

As hybrid meeting rooms become central to business operations, they also become potential targets for security breaches. Mission Viejo installers with cybersecurity expertise implement comprehensive protection measures that safeguard sensitive information while maintaining system usability. Understanding these security considerations helps businesses evaluate installation proposals and ensure appropriate protections are included.

  • Zero Trust Architecture: Implementation of security frameworks that verify every user and device attempting to access meeting systems, regardless of location or network.
  • Multi-Factor Authentication: Requiring multiple verification methods before granting access to meeting controls and sensitive content.
  • Data Loss Prevention: Systems that monitor and control what information can be shared during meetings, preventing unauthorized distribution of sensitive content.
  • Secure Guest Access: Protocols for managing external participants without compromising network security, including temporary credentials and limited system access.
  • Security Monitoring: Continuous surveillance of meeting system activity to detect and respond to unusual behavior that might indicate a security breach.

Advanced installers incorporate AI-driven security tools that identify potential threats based on usage patterns, automatically implementing additional protections when suspicious activity is detected. They also develop comprehensive incident response plans that outline steps to take if security is compromised, minimizing potential damage. 3. What ongoing maintenance requirements should I anticipate for hybrid meeting room systems?

Hybrid meeting technologies require regular maintenance to ensure optimal performance and security. This typically includes quarterly firmware updates for hardware components, monthly software patches, regular testing of all system elements, annual recalibration of audio and visual equipment, and periodic security assessments. Professional installers usually offer maintenance contracts that cover these requirements, with options ranging from basic support to comprehensive managed services. The most effective maintenance programs combine scheduled preventive activities with continuous remote monitoring that can detect potential issues before they impact business operations.

4. How does a professional installer address network bandwidth requirements for hybrid meeting rooms?

Professional installers conduct thorough network assessments before implementing hybrid meeting technology, measuring current capacity and identifying potential bottlenecks. They calculate bandwidth requirements based on the number of simultaneous meetings, typical participant counts, and the types of content being shared. Solutions may include dedicated network connections for meeting rooms, quality of service configurations that prioritize meeting traffic, local caching of frequently shared content, and compression technologies that reduce bandwidth consumption. 5. What future-proofing considerations should be included when designing hybrid meeting spaces?

Future-proofing hybrid meeting spaces involves several key considerations. Infrastructure should include excess capacity for power, data, and cooling to accommodate additional equipment. Cable pathways should allow for easy upgrades without major construction. Equipment racks should have space for expansion, and network infrastructure should support higher bandwidths than currently required. The physical room design should be flexible enough to accommodate different meeting configurations and technologies. Software platforms should be selected based on their integration capabilities and development roadmaps. Professional installers should provide a technology refresh plan that outlines potential upgrade paths as new solutions emerge, helping businesses budget for future enhancements.
